Madrigal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:MDGL – Get Free Report)’s share price traded up 10.5% on Tuesday after Bank of America upgraded the stock from an underperform rating to a neutral rating. Bank of America now has a $445.00 price target on the stock, up from their previous price target of $266.00. Madrigal Pharmaceuticals traded as high as $454.98 and last traded at $455.8450. 425,857 shares traded hands during mid-day trading, an increase of 16% from the average session volume of 366,438 shares. The stock had previously closed at $412.35.

Madrigal Pharmaceuticals (NASDAQ:MDGL –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, November 4th. The biopharmaceutical company reported ($5.08) E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of ($2.01) by ($3.07). The company had revenue of $287.27 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$244.33 million. Madrigal Pharmaceuticals had a negative return on equity of 38.38% and a negative net margin of 54.68%. Equities research analysts predict that Madrigal Pharmaceuticals, Inc. will post -23.47 EPS for the current year.
About Madrigal Pharmaceuticals
Madrigal Pharmaceuticals, Inc, a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company, focuses on the development of therapeutics for the treatment of non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H) in the United States. Its lead product candidate is resmetirom, a liver-directed thyroid hormone receptor beta agonist, which is in Phase 3 clinical trials for treating NASH.
